Steve Winwood - Back In The High Life Again
The title track from Steve Winwood's 1986 Grammy award winning Album "Back In The High Life"
According to co-writer Will Jennings...
"We wrote those songs in the fall of '84, and it was a long spell before he got in the studio in New York. We had 'Higher Love' and several other songs, including 'The Finer Things.' And then it was toward the end of my stay over there and we still needed some other songs. I had 'Back in the High Life Again' in this book that I carry with me of titles. I pulled that out and I suddenly found the rest of the song, and I wrote that in about 30 minutes, and left it with Steve to put a melody to. So this is in '84. And then I went back to California, and it was a year, I guess, before he went in the studio, sometime in '85. I called one day and talked to Russ Titelman who was producing the album. They were doing it in New York. I asked him how it was going, and he said, 'Oh it's going great.' He said 'Higher Love' came out great and 'The Finer Things.' I asked him how 'Back In The High Life' would come out. There was this little pause, and he said, 'Steve hasn't shown me that song.' So turns out that Steve had not written the music to it yet and he at that time was going through a divorce. And because of the divorce, his wife got everything in the house, this big house in England. So he came up from London and went out to this house, which he still lives in and he had for years before he was married, and everything was gone, except there was a mandolin over in the corner of the living room. It was winter and it was dreary. He went over and picked up the mandolin, and he already had the words in his head, and that's when he wrote the melody. He went back and not only cut a big hit which still is played so much today, but it was the title track of the album. And if I hadn't asked about it, it would have just gone by, so that's one that was saved at the last minute."
Says Jennings, "You just need to get the feel of what they want to do, where they're coming from and what their life has been. The soulfulness comes into writing the truth of the singer. If you're writing with or particularly for a singer, you try to get inside them."
- Singer/ song writer James Taylor contributed background vocal.
-The video was shot at the Southern Railway station in Manassas, Virginia.
-The late Warren Zevon did a low-key, acoustic cover of this song on his 2000 album "Life'll Kill Ya".

Steve Winwood - While You See A Chance
An amazing song from Steve Winwood's 1980 album "Arc Of A Diver"
-In this classic 1981 hit "While You See a Chance", in a stanza where Steve sings "And that old gray wind is blowing and there's nothing left worth knowing," Winwood accidentally overdubs "nothing left..." with "no one left..."
-The entire track was thrown together in a relatively quick fashion, and at one point Winwood accidentally deleted the drum track introduction in preparation for vocals. The keyboard introduction that he composed on the spot to replace it is now iconic.
-According to co-writer, Will Jennings... "The lyric of the song is about realizing that you are all alone in this life and you have to do with it what you can. There's an old English expression called "Fake it till you make it." If you don't have romance in your life, meaning in the broader sense, really, something to make life interesting, just imagine it until it's there."
-Steve recorded it in his own studio in Gloucestershire UK. He played virtually all the instruments on the album. The mastering engineer had to crank a whole lot of bass onto the final tape as it was bass light, probably due to Winwood's studio monitors being bass heavy.
-Many radio stations, when the song was released, played the video version of the single which was quite noticeable for the edit near half way during the song. It is believed to have been done this way as the song in full runs for over five minutes.
